- Sirtuin-1 (SIRT-1) has anti-oxidative, anti-inflammatory, and anti-apoptotic effects, and is involved in aging and age-related disorders.
- Previous studies with small sample sizes found no differences in salivary SIRT-1 levels between periodontitis patients and healthy subjects.
- This study aimed to analyze salivary SIRT-1 levels in a larger sample (144 subjects: 85 healthy, 59 with periodontitis).
- Salivary SIRT-1 concentrations < 1.2 ng/mL were independently associated with periodontitis (OR = 2.84; p = 0.04).
- SIRT-1 showed moderate diagnostic capability for periodontitis (AUC = 74%; p < 0.001) but is not sufficient alone.
- Low salivary SIRT-1 levels may be linked to periodontitis, but further research is needed to confirm findings.
